Transaction 74023486adf3a21481f719a0f1066669cf5197817ccc24da3bf5ecb536da1b1b

1 Input
2 Outputs
  • 74023486adf3a21481f719a0f1066669cf5197817ccc24da3bf5ecb536da1b1b:0
  • value  15840
    address  3CqoZ5RPYFn8xBkEMWUacUmvGBe4QQt41b
  • 74023486adf3a21481f719a0f1066669cf5197817ccc24da3bf5ecb536da1b1b:1
  • value  776252
    address  1Dfyjed5vTmoDjjqrb8iY5acTu8RfQte6a